新托福预测写作Task2高分范文:
movetoanewcity
09.10.31NA
Doyouagreeordisagreewiththefollowingstatement?
Itisoftennotagoodideatomovetoanewcityoranewcountrybecauseyouwillloseoldfriends.
Sampleanswer (5paragraphs,363words)
Withtherapiddevelopmentoftechnologies,theprocessofglobalizationisprogressingquickly.Peoplehavebecomemorelikelytomovetoanothercityorcountryinpursuitoftheirgoals.Somepeoplecontendthatitisabadideatomovetoanewplacebecausethosewhorelocatelosetheircurrentfriends.Istronglydisagreewiththisstatementforseveralreasons.
Peoplewhomovetonewlocationsdonotneedtolosetheirfriends,astheycantakeadvantageoftechnologiesinmostcountriestokeepintouch.Peoplecanusenumerousmeansofmakingcontact,includingtelephone,e-mail,andonlinechatsoftware.Thesetechnologieseasilyallowonetomaintainrelationships.Forexample,myfamilymovedfromHengyangtoChangshaseveralyearsagoduetomyparents’workassignment.Sinceourmove,IhavepreservedmyrelationshipswithmyoldfriendsinHengyangbychattingonline;weevenseeeachotheroftenthroughvideoconferencing.Inaddition,asthetransportationsystemhasexpandedquickly,itisveryconvenientformetotaketripstovisitmyoldfriendsnowandthen.
Furthermore,movingtonewplacesbroadenspeople’shorizons,supportingtheirpersonaldevelopment.Bytravelinginternationally,onecangainabetterunderstandingofvariouscustoms,histories,religions,andcultures.Withabroadview,peoplebecomemoreoptimisticandactive.Myuncle,forexample,usedtobeveryshyandunsureofhispurposewhenhewasyoung;hebecamemuchmoreconfidentandpositiveafterhefinishedhisundergraduateprogramabroad.Hehasalwayssaidthathisfouryearsofcampuslifeabroadchangedhiswayoflookingatlife.
Thoughtechnologiesallowpeopletoconnectwitholdfriendsatadistance,theydohavesomedisadvantages.Forinstance,whenfriendswholiveindifferentcitiescannotcommunicatefacetoface,theymayhaveunnecessarymisunderstandingsanddisagreements.Despitethesechallenges,Iinsistthatitisnotbadtomovetootherplaces,giventheenormousbenefitsthatrelocatingcanbring.
Inconclusion,peoplewhomovetonewcitiesandcountriesshouldnotworryaboutlosingtheirfriends,as technologicaladvancementscansecuretheirrelationshipsandmovingcanofferthemgreatbenefits.

新托福预测100213NA写作【版本1】范文:
critisimandsuccess
100213NA:
Doyouagreewiththefollowingstatement?
Inateam,thosewhodonotacceptothers’criticismcannotsucceed.
Sampleanswer
Thereisnowayonecanavoidcriticismfromotherpeople.Criticismisverynaturalasmostpeoplecanseetheworldonlyfromtheirpointofview.Hencetheyareunabletoseetheholisticpictureoftheworldandtheneedfordiversity.Ifapersondoesnotknowhowtohandlecriticismfromothermembersofateam,he/shemaytendtoreactnegativelytowardsthem,andhis/herworkperformanceisnotlikelytobesuccessful.
Whileworkinginateam,youcannotbesurethatyouropinions,decisionsorapproachesarealwayscorrect,andinmanycasesyouwillneedtoacceptcriticismfromothermemberswhowillpointoutyourmistakesanddirectyoutowardstherightcourseofaction.Insports,forexample,especiallyinteamsportssuchasfootballorbasketball,anyoneplayer,nomatterhowskillfulorexperiencedthisplayeris,willmakemistakesduringagame,sometimeseven“deadlyones”.Andwhencriticismspourinafterthegame,fromteammembers,thecoach,orteamfans,thebeststrategyisnottorunawayorfindexcusestoavoidthesecriticisms,buttolistentoandaccepttheircriticisms,taketheiradvice,andtryhardtoimprovethenexttime.
Othertimes,youmayoccasionallybemisinterpreted,misjudged,andthereforeunfairlycriticized,butinafriendlyworkenvironment,thesecriticismsareoftenmadeoutofgoodwill.Sointhesecasesitmaybehelpfulthatyoulistencarefullytowhatotherssayandtrytounderstandtheirpointsofview,insteadofreactingaggressivelytowardsthem,whichmayharmteamrelationshipinthelongrun.Ithinkweallhaveseen,inreallifeoronaTVprogram,asituationwheretwopeoplestartedyellingateachotheronlybecauseonethinkstheotherisintentionallyfindingfault.Butoftenthisisduetoasimplemisunderstandingormiscommunication.Asuccessfulteamplayerwouldfirstofallstaycalm,summarizetheotherperson’sperspective,thenfindouttherootofsuchmisunderstanding,andfinallyresolvetheconflict.
Criticism,especiallyifitseemsunjustified,canbepainfulandcauseadefensivereaction,butatrulysuccessfulteamplayerwillfacecriticismwithpatienceandprofessionalism,andturnitintoaconstructiveforcetowardsfinalsuccess.
新托福预测100213NA写作【版本2】范文:
teamsuccess
100213NA:
Doyouagreewiththefollowingstatement?
Peopleholdingdifferentviewscannotachievesuccessasateam..

Sampleanswer
Teamworkhasbecomeanimportantpartoftheworkingculture.Mostcompaniesnowrealizetheimportanceofteamworkbecauseinourmodernworldmanytasksarebecomingincreasinglycomplexthattheyrequireateamwithmultipleskillstocomplete.Butisittruethateverymemberintheteamshouldhavethesameopinioninordertoachievesuccess?
Frommypointofview,mostofthetime,ateamconsistingofdivergentopinionsaremorelikelytosucceed.
Asweallknow,itisnotpracticaltoexpecteveryoneinateamtohavethesamepointofview,becauseeveryoneisadifferentindividualwhohashisorherownpersonalityandideasduetodifferentbackgrounds.However,oftensuchdifferencesinopinionscanberesolvedaftersufficientdiscussionandespeciallyaftercoordinationbyateamleader.Ioncejoinedafootballteambackinhighschool.Everytimebeforeafootballmatch,teammemberswouldsittogetheranddiscussstrategiesinordertodefeatouropponentinthenextgame.Ofteninsuchdiscussionmanydifferentvoicescanbeheard:
Somemembersadvocateoffensebutothersemphasizedefense.Theteamleader,thecaptainofourteam,whoisaveryexperiencedfootballplayer,oftenplayedaveryimportantrole.Hewouldmakethefinaldecisiononteamdeployment,andhisstrategyalwaysbalancedoffensewithdefense.Underhisleadership,ourteamhadwonfourchampionshipsintheschoolfootballleague.
Furthermore,evenifdifferentopinionscannotberesolved,itdoesnotmeanateamwillfail,becausesometimesdifferenceinopinionswillleadtosomebrightthoughtsandcreativeideas.Inacompany,forexample,themajorityofteammembers,becauseofcompanytraditionorroutine,areoftenconfinedtoastereotypedviewandtheywouldtendtoagreewitheachotherpassively.Butthebestideasoftencomeafterheateddiscussionamongteammembers,whoholddifferentorevenconflictingviews.Sotheyneedsomeonedifferent,someonewhocansaynototheoldpractice,togenerateinnovativeideasandachieveimportantbreakthroughs.
Inaword,havingthesameopinionorattitudetotheissueisnotaguaranteeofsuccessfulteamwork.Indeed,wecanlearnalotfromthedifferentviews,aslongastheteamhasadefiniteaimandisledbyanexperiencedteamleader.
